EA Sports College Football 26 refines the series’ return with noticeable improvements to gameplay, Dynasty, and Road to Glory. Controls feel more responsive, animations are smoother, and the authentic college atmosphere shines through stadiums and traditions. Issues like conservative AI, slow menus, and lack of servers in some regions remain, but overall this is a solid and immersive step forward that reinforces confidence in the franchise’s future.- MeuPlayStation

The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ion Remastered delivers beautiful visuals and nostalgic charm, faithfully preserving the original's quests and world. However, its dated gameplay, poor performance, and frequent bugs seriously hinder the experience. A love letter to longtime fans—but for newcomers, it may feel clunky, frustrating, and overshadowed by more modern RPGs.- MeuPlayStation

Age of Mythology: Retold is a definitive edition that successfully revitalizes the classic strategy game by blending various mythologies into a cohesive narrative. Players follow the hero Arkantos in a campaign featuring 33 diverse missions, engaging with Greek, Egyptian, and Norse deities. While the game introduces new content and supports multiplayer modes, some graphical shortcomings and control adaptations for consoles could be improved. Overall, it offers a nostalgic and enjoyable experience for fans and newcomers alike.- MeuPlayStation

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ves marks SNK’s strong return to its classic franchise, blending modern mechanics like the REV System with legacy features such as S.P.G. The game offers deep yet accessible combat, varied single-player modes, and stylish visuals. While UI navigation and online matchmaking need refinement, strong rollback netcode and gameplay depth make this a worthy revival.- MeuPlayStation
